GAC Filter is a kind of granular activated carbon commonly used in RO water purifiers Pre-Filter. In addition, the main raw material of granular activated carbon can also be an apricot shell, walnut shell, and other fruit shells or coal such as anthracite. Activated carbon formed by activating these as raw materials has formed many small pores, but the size distribution of these pores is not uniform. According to the diameter, they are divided into micropores below 2nm, macropores above 50nm, and mesopores in the middle ( Also called transition hole). Some pores can even reach 1000nm

GAC Filter -Granular Activated Carbon (85%~90% of granular activated carbon) is used for water treatment and gas adsorption treatment. Its particle size is 500~5000μm. The pore structure of GAC generally has a three-dispersed pore distribution, which has The International Society for Pure and Applied Chemistry (IUPAC) classifies macropores with a pore diameter greater than 50 nm, as well as mesopores (transition pores) with a diameter of 2.0 to 50 nm and micropores with a diameter of less than 2.0 nm.
1. The GAC filter element can be compacted by filling with activated carbon filter material and a specially designed sponge inside. The PP melt-blown filter layer at the end of 20um can effectively prevent the fine particles from seeping out.
2. GAC filter can effectively filter out different colors, odors, residual chlorine, colloidal substances, and volatile organic compounds in water.
3. GAC filter can effectively inhibit the growth of bacteria.
